#195630 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#195630 is composed of 9.8% red, 33.7% green and 18.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 70.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 44.2% yellow and 66.3% black. It has a hue angle of 142.6 degrees, a saturation of 55% and a lightness of 21.8%. #195630 color hex could be obtained by blending #32ac60 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006633.

#195630 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#195630 has RGB values of R:25, G:86, B:48 and CMYK values of C:0.71, M:0, Y:0.44, K:0.66. Its decimal value is 1660464.
